Product Overview

ASTM A312 TP347H is a high-temperature, stabilized austenitic stainless steel with added columbium (niobium) for improved creep strength. When made into Serrated Fin Tubes using High-Frequency Welding (HFW), this tube becomes ideal for furnace convection sections, offering enhanced heat transfer efficiency and extended service life under cyclic thermal stress and oxidizing conditions.

Chemical Composition – ASTM A312 TP347H

Element Content (%)
C 0.04 – 0.10
Mn ≤ 2.00
P ≤ 0.040
S ≤ 0.030
Si ≤ 1.00
Cr 17.0 – 19.0
Ni 9.0 – 13.0
Nb (Cb) 10 × C min
Fe Balance

Mechanical Properties – TP347H

Property Value
Tensile Strength ≥ 515 MPa
Yield Strength ≥ 205 MPa
Elongation ≥ 35%
Hardness (HBW) ≤ 192 HB
Max. Working Temp ~ 1050°C (1922°F)

Advantages of TP347H Serrated Fin Tube

  • High Temperature Resistance
    Ideal for superheaters, heaters, and furnaces, TP347H withstands long-term service at elevated temperatures without creep deformation.

  • Improved Heat Transfer Efficiency
    The serrated fin design increases turbulence and surface area, boosting heat transfer while minimizing fouling.

  • Oxidation & Corrosion Resistance
    Excellent performance in oxidizing atmospheres, especially in fuel-fired furnaces.

  • Creep-Strength Enhanced
    Addition of niobium enhances structural stability under high stress and thermal cycling.

  • Weldability and Fabrication
    Good weldability with standard procedures; suitable for custom-designed fin configurations.

Application in Furnace Systems

The Serrated Fin Tube made of ASTM A312 TP347H is specifically used in:

  • Convection Section of Furnaces
    Absorbs radiant heat and transfers it efficiently to the working fluid (steam, oil, or gas).

  • Heater Banks & Superheaters
    Installed where both thermal efficiency and material durability are critical.

  • Refinery Fired Heaters
    In hydrocarbon processing, TP347H fin tubes are used in crude, reformer, and hydrotreater furnaces.
